Transaction 30a518f3a867523f57d8d250c20c80d2664c1d161f50c4f0cb493feab5876c14
1 Input
2 Outputs
- 30a518f3a867523f57d8d250c20c80d2664c1d161f50c4f0cb493feab5876c14:0
- 30a518f3a867523f57d8d250c20c80d2664c1d161f50c4f0cb493feab5876c14:1
value 670000
address 17TiNpCy9SuVLe4L9TJQX6XB6ufFipurwD
value 1771337
address 1DU9875X8D5Gokq1Qfpejdkwgg3HETy8YV